Encoding & crypto: use the shared crates
The workspace has two centralizing crates. Never reach for the underlying
primitives or hand-roll an encoder/decoder/hash loop — add to (or call) these:
pocopine-crypto — hashing, checksums, keyed MACs. Wraps sha2,
md-5, crc32c, hmac. no_std + alloc.
pocopine-codec — base64 + percent-encoding (+ serde adapters). Wraps
base64, percent-encoding. no_std + alloc.
Both are safe for wasm crates. Add with { workspace = true }. (Integration
tests reach a crate's normal [dependencies], so they don't need a dev-dep.)

percent_encode uses the RFC 3986 unreserved set (A-Za-z0-9-._~,
uppercase hex, non-ASCII always escaped) — the right default for path
segments, query keys/values, and fragments. Reach for percent_encode_set
only when a provider mandates a different set (e.g. the GCS JSON object-name
set, or SAS values needing the strict NON_ALPHANUMERIC set).
The API is the contract — extend it, don't bypass it
If a primitive you need isn't wrapped yet (a new digest, a different MAC, a new
codec), add it to the shared crate and call that, rather than depending on
the raw crate from a consumer. Each crate re-exports its underlying crates
(pocopine_crypto::{sha2, md5, crc32c, hmac}, pocopine_codec::{base64, percent_encoding}) as an escape hatch — prefer growing the API over using them.
Genuine exceptions (leave as-is)
argon2 (password hashing → PHC strings) is intentionally not in
pocopine-crypto, which is plain digests/checksums/MACs. Keep argon2
direct in pocopine-auth-credentials.
pocopine-core's router/return_to.rs percent_decode_strict is a
strict, reject-on-malformed, reject-non-UTF-8 decoder for a security path.
It is deliberately bespoke; pocopine_codec::percent_decode is lossy.
